TEN YEARS LATER

Alec waved to his cheery customer who was now content and full as she exited his coffee shop. He wiped the counter with a napkin and entered her bill in the computer. He tilted his head upwards to see Jace place the used coffee cups in the tray and clean the unoccupied table. His eyes moved to the left corner where Izzy was attending to an old couple

Alec smiled at his two siblings. He loved them the most in the world. The day he had stopped talking, his family had been very supportive. At the beginning Maryse did take him to many doctors and therapists but they all had only one answer : Nothing was wrong with Alec's vocal cords. It was a case of selective mutism caused by a trauma and it was completely up to Alec when or if he would ever talk again. Eventually it was decided they would learn sign language and not put pressure on Alec

After Alec had finished his graduation, he immediately took over his father's businesss. He loved working in the coffee shop. This way he felt close to his father. His siblings who were in the last year of the college came everyday to help their brother with his work. Most of the people who were regular customer knew about Alec's condition and for the new customers, Jace and Izzy were always there who stood next to him like two protective pillars.
